Because bottled Absinthe is expensive as well as because of legislation in certain countries, so many people are considering making their very own Absinthe from a kit that they can purchase online.
You can find different kits available. Some kits give you herbs that you have to steep while others give you herbs that you have to mix with alcohol then filter following several days.
The kit available from Green Devil includes two blends of herbs, a main blend along with a finishing blend, muslin bags for infusing the herbs, their own unique micron filtration system, a pamphlet made up of instructions and data and two bottle labels. The kit is made up of enough herbs to produce 2 liters of Absinthe and the herbs consist of wormwood, hyssop, calamus, anise and fennel along with others.
Utilizing their standard kit, you can create 2 liters of Absinthe for $34.95 which has a thujone content of 70-90mg.
